Sociability
Pronunciation: /ˈsoʊˈsiˈaɪˈəbɪɫəˌti/
Sociability (noun)
- The quality of being friendly and enjoying talking and spending time with other people.
- A person’s readiness to join social events and communicate with others.
- The degree to which someone behaves in a social way, such as talking, sharing, and interacting.
Examples
- Her sociability makes strangers feel welcome.
- Sociability helps him connect quickly with others.
